2005 Holden Caprice vs. 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420

To start off, 2005 Holden Caprice is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 would be higher. At 4,196 cc (8 cylinders), 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 is equipped with a bigger engine.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Holden Caprice (369 Nm) has 40 more torque (in Nm) than 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420. (329 Nm). This means 2005 Holden Caprice will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420.
